Understanding Non-UK Bookmakers

Non-UK bookmakers are online betting platforms that operate outside the jurisdiction of the United Kingdom. These operators may be licensed in various countries, often providing an alternative to UK-based sportsbooks that are tightly regulated by the UK Gambling Commission. Non-UK betting sites can cater to a wider array of markets and may have different offerings in terms of bonuses, betting options, and promotional strategies.

Potential Drawbacks

Regulatory Concerns

While less stringent regulation can be seen as an advantage, it can also pose risks for bettors. Many non-UK bookmakers may not offer the same level of consumer protection and dispute resolution mechanisms that UK-licensed bookmakers are required to provide. It’s essential for bettors to do their due diligence and ensure they are using a reputable platform that adheres to fair play principles.

Payment Processing Issues

Bettors may encounter difficulties with payment processing when using non-UK bookmakers. Some financial institutions may be hesitant to support transactions with offshore entities, leading to potential delays in deposits and withdrawals. Bettors should research the payment methods accepted by these bookmakers and ensure they have reliable options for funding their accounts.

How to Choose the Right Non-UK Bookmaker

When selecting a non-UK bookmaker, bettors should consider several factors to ensure a positive betting experience:

Reputation and Licensing

Always check if the bookmaker is properly licensed in a reputable jurisdiction. This information can usually be found in the site’s footer or in their terms and conditions. Reading reviews and checking for any player complaints can also help gauge the reputation of the bookmaker.

Market Coverage and Odds

Compare the available sports and odds offered by different bookmakers. This can help you determine where you can find the best value. Additionally, check if they offer live betting and mobile applications for a more comprehensive experience.

Payment Options

Make sure the bookmaker supports your preferred payment methods. Look for options that allow for quick deposits and withdrawals, and check if they charge any fees for transactions.

Customer Support

Reliable customer support is critical, especially when dealing with withdrawals or technical issues. Look for bookmakers that offer multiple contact options, including live chat, email, and phone support.
